The Youth Sports Economy and Labor Market Dynamics

This chapter examines the stagnation in job movement within the labor market and its ramifications for job seekers and employers while also exploring the rising financial interests of private equity in youth sports. It discusses the challenges parents face with costs and accessibility in youth sports, as well as the potential for private equity firms to improve the landscape or exacerbate profit-driven challenges. Ultimately, the chapter highlights the necessity for better quality sports experiences for young athletes amidst escalating costs and inefficiencies.
